The Price Collapse No One Saw Coming

MTwo years ago, voice AI demanded serious investment. Implementation ran into the tens of thousands, and per-minute pricing made ongoing operation prohibitive for high-volume businesses. The technology worked — but the economics locked out the small businesses it could have helped most.

That barrier is gone. Retell AI, one of the leading voice agent platforms, now offers conversation pricing as low as $0.07 per minute on basic voice engines, rising to about $0.08 for premium voices like ElevenLabs or OpenAI. More complete setups — voice infrastructure, text-to-speech, the language model, and telephony all stitched together — typically land between $0.13 and $0.31 per minute depending on configuration. The biggest shift from even a year ago: no mandatory base subscription. You pay for the minutes you actually use.

Run the numbers for a small law firm taking 50 calls a day at an average of 4 minutes each. That's roughly 4,200 billable minutes a month, or about $340 at $0.08 per minute. Set that against the $3,000–$5,000 a month a full-time receptionist costs, and the comparison stops being close. Even if a meaningful share of those calls get transferred to a human, the savings hold. Put another way: industry estimates put the cost of an AI-handled call near $0.40, versus $7–$12 for a live agent.

What This Means for Your Local Business

The $0.08 price point unlocks options that didn't pencil out six months ago. Small businesses can now run professional AI receptionists that schedule appointments, answer the questions callers ask over and over, capture lead details, and route urgent calls to a human the moment one is needed.

Take the HVAC contractor who dreads after-hours calls. An AI receptionist screens every incoming call, recognizes a genuine emergency from the caller's intent, and connects time-sensitive requests straight to the on-call tech. Routine maintenance gets booked for the next business day. The contractor stops paying someone to answer phones at 11 PM — and no emergency call slips through.

For law firms, the fit is just as clean. Early inquiries are full of repetition: practice areas, how to book a consultation, how fees work. An AI receptionist handles that first pass, captures the case details, and hands serious prospects to an attorney. The firm still makes the human connection that matters; the administrative weight shifts to automation.

Contractors and service businesses see the same pattern. Estimate requests, timeline questions, scheduling — all of it can flow through a system that never takes a day off, never has an off day, and never forgets to follow up.


Beyond cost: the quality factor

Price is only half the story. The other half is that voice AI got good — good enough to answer the standard objection that "customers will hate talking to a robot."

Modern AI voice agents resolve 55–70% of calls on first contact, meaning most callers are handled start to finish without a human stepping in. Organizations deploying voice AI have reported customer satisfaction gains of up to 30%, with first response times dropping from over six hours to under four minutes. That kind of speed doesn't just trim costs — it changes how a caller experiences your business.

The technology has crossed a threshold where, in a brief interaction, most callers can't tell they're talking to AI. Natural pacing, sensible handling of unexpected questions, and clean handoffs to a person when the moment calls for it are now table stakes, not premium features.
